Shreyas Iyer’s Mullanpur nightmare continues, PBKS Nemesis Falls to Josh Hazlewood

Josh Hazlewood was 4th in the 6th IPL game Shreyas Iyer.

Punjab Kings needed Shreyas Iyer to pull through on Thursday but their skipper’s nightmarish run at Mullanpur continued. Playing IPL 2025 Qualifier 1, PBKS find themselves in a spot of bother with a top order collapse in the powerplay. Shreyas, his team’s leading run-getter also fell cheaply to arch nemesis Josh Hazlewood inside the powerplay.

Josh Hazlewood returns to bag ‘bunny’ Shreyas Iyer

Shreyas Iyer fronted up against a spirited Josh Hazlewood. The Australian has the wood over the PBKs skipper and on Thursday used that to good effect. The hosts had already lost Priyansh Arya and Prabhsimran Singh early, neecding Shreyas to rebuild. However, Iyer felt the pressure of the match up and attempted an ugly slog. Shreyas could only find an edge through to Phil Salt behind the stumps.

Before the PBKS vs RCB qualifier, Hazlewood had dimissed Shreyas Iyer thrice in 5 innings in the IPL. The Punjab Kings captain has scored 9 runs off 19 balls against the Aussie pacer, striking at just 47.36. It took Hazlewood just 3 deliveries to prize out Shreyas on Thursday, sending Punjab Kings on the brink.

Shreyas Iyer’s Mullanpur nightmare continues

Shreyas Iyer is Punjab Kings’ leading run getter this season. However, the PBKS skipper’s runs have come away from home, with the 30-year-old struggling to ace the Mullanpur conditions. With the IPL 2025 Qualifier 1 at home for the Kings, they needed Shreyas to fire in all cylinders and break that jinx. In IPL 2025, his highest score at Mullanpur is 10. He has been dismissed for single digit scores 4 times, including a duck.
